Squeaking noise 200

I'm hearing a bad high-pitched squeaking noise when I'm moving out in my 1990 240 wagon. Slow speeds. Pulling out from parking or from a stop sign. Noise seems to be vaguely tied to rotation of wheels, i.e. rythm is somewhat related to rpms of wheels, but not exactly. Seems to be coming from the rear and not the front, but hard to tell.

I hear this noise up to speeds of about 30mph.

Bad during 90-degree turns, too.

My local Volvo dealership just replaced the rear brake pads -- they thought that would fix the problem. Not too long ago, they also tightened the emergency brake.

Mechanic today suggested I apply the e-brake while moving to clean it out -- he thought it might have been dust or a little stone. I did that and notice no improvement. Not sure how long of a run he was suggesting I keep the e-brake on.

Any thoughts or ideas for a newbie who's not mechanically inclined? The noise seems to be getting louder over the past couple of weeks.
